MSI Gaming GE63 9SG-626 Raider RGB RAM upgrade specifications
MSI GE63 9SG-626 Raider RGB gaming laptop supports DDR4-SDRAM memory upgrades through two SO-DIMM slots. Maximum RAM capacity reaches 64 GB. Memory specifications include DDR4 operating frequency of 2666 MHz. Compatible upgrades utilize SO-DIMM form factor modules. Current laptop configuration supports standard DDR4 memory technology for performance enhancement and multitasking capabilities.
Memory Upgrade Specifications
| Specification | Value |
|---|---|
| Memory slots | 2x SO-DIMM |
| Form factor | SO-DIMM |
| Memory type | DDR4-SDRAM |
| Frequency | 2666 MHz |
| Maximum RAM | 64 GB |
| Voltage | 1.2V |
| Number of pins | 260-pin |
| Interface | PC4 |
| PC Speed Rating | PC4-2666 (PC4-21328) |
| Bandwidth | 21.3 GB/s |
| Laptop Release date | 19 April 2019 |
Additional Notes
- The dual channel configuration requirement necessitates installing modules in matched pairs to avoid significant memory bandwidth throttling during high demand gaming scenarios.
- Upgrading the MSI GE63 9SG-626 Raider RGB to the maximum capacity requires the removal of all factory installed modules because the system lacks empty expansion slots.
- Installing memory with frequencies higher than 2666 MHz results in automatic downclocking to match the hardware chipset limitations of the motherboard.
- Physical access to the SO-DIMM slots requires the removal of the entire bottom chassis panel which may involve piercing factory seal stickers in certain regional jurisdictions.
- The 64 GB density limit implies support for 32 GB unbuffered non-ECC modules per slot but precludes the use of high density server grade registered memory.
- Thermal dissipation for the memory modules relies on passive internal airflow since the slots lack dedicated heat spreaders or direct active cooling paths.
- Mixing modules with different latency ratings forces the system to default to the slowest common timing profile to maintain platform stability.
